Black Mold Remediation in Jupiter, FL

Black mold remediation services involve the identification, removal, and thorough cleaning of mold growth caused by excess moisture or water damage. These projects typically include affected areas such as bathrooms, basements, attics, or any space where mold has developed on surfaces like drywall, ceilings, or insulation. Property owners often seek this service after noticing visible mold, experiencing musty odors, or dealing with health concerns related to mold exposure. Understanding the extent of mold growth and the underlying moisture problem is important before requesting remediation, as effective removal requires addressing both the mold and its source.

Homeowners should be aware that black mold remediation involves specialized cleaning methods and may require the removal of contaminated materials to ensure complete elimination. It’s common for property owners to inquire about the scope of work, potential for re-growth, and any necessary repairs to prevent future issues. Proper remediation aims to improve indoor air quality and reduce health risks, making it a crucial step following water intrusion or visible mold development in residential spaces.

FAQ

Black Mold Remediation Questions

What is black mold remediation? Black mold remediation involves removing mold growth from indoor surfaces and preventing its return to ensure a healthier living environment.

When should property owners consider mold removal? Mold removal is recommended when visible black mold is detected or if there are signs of mold-related health issues indoors.

What areas are typically treated during mold remediation? Common treatment areas include bathrooms, basements, attics, and other spaces prone to moisture buildup.

How can property owners prevent mold growth? Controlling moisture, fixing leaks promptly, and maintaining proper ventilation help prevent mold from developing indoors.
